Sony launches Micro Vault Tiny Drives

1.jpg

Measuring in at about twice the size of a thumbnail and weighing in at only 2.4mm, Sony’s new Micro Vault Drives offer an extremely small and surprisingly durable solution to portable data storage. The minuscule drives have varying storage capacities ranging from 256mb up to 2gb. Launched in the far east markets earlier this year, Micro Vault Drives have now been released in Europe. They maintain the simplicity of any USB device, essentially just plug-and-play hardware, however their small size enables them to fit anywhere on the go. Each drive also contains preloaded compression software that automatically compresses data being written to enabling it to hold three times the amount of information. Each drive also comes with a rubber casing case that is equipped with a clip and strap. via Tech Digest
